Job Description
  • Role context:
    • Responsible for helping to translate branded content strategy into tactical custom content programs
    • Lead the day-to-day needs relating to content partnerships, including conversations with partners and clients throughout the execution process
    • Work closely with the Content Director and Account team to support them in developing strategy, and connecting content programs into the integrated marketing approach
    Responsibilities
    • Develop tactical custom content recommendations with partners that could include custom digital video, influencer marketing, content integrations, social activations, and custom sponsorships
    • Meet and evaluate partners in offering content marketing solutions to identify best partners and partnership opportunities
    • Negotiate partnership deals that deliver the most value to clients
    • Lead structured brainstorms that generate original ideas that can inform the RFP process
    • Serve as project manager, ensuring all parties are accountable for meeting deadlines and delivering within approved plan parameters
    • Supervise the content creation process, including providing clear input on key deliverables such as talent selection, storyboards and content rough cuts
    • Collaborate with Wavemaker planning teams to ensure content partnerships are an interconnected part of the media plan
    • Write client presentations and partner briefs
    • Cultivate client relationships, demonstrating a keen understanding of their business and how content fits within it
    • Develop junior team members foundational understanding of content and client services
    The candidate:
    • Comfortable executing various brand content activation tactics, such as influencer marketing, social activations, original brand video, and custom media partnerships and sponsorships
    • Ability to interpret client briefs and determine the opportunity for custom content
    • Working knowledge of content development process
    • Experience in launching content partnerships for clients
    • Proactive, a team player, demonstrate leadership
    • Proven experience in building strong client relationships
    • Flair for presenting creative ideas
